In Tennessee, expungement grants individuals the chance to remove their criminal records, allowing them move forward with a new beginning. For many, previous mistakes—whether they caused an arrest or conviction—can create significant challenges in securing jobs, housing, or educational opportunities. However, the Tennessee expungement process offers a legal avenue to get certain eligible records erased.

Expungement in Tennessee is not automatic; individuals must request and meet specific criteria. Only peaceful misdemeanor convictions, some Class E felonies, and dismissed charges are eligible for expungement. In some cases, the individual may also have to finish a waiting period before being eligible to apply. Additionally, all court penalties, fees, and restitution must be completely settled to proceed with the process.
